Calcium and Inotropes in Critical Care

This chapter explores the essential role of calcium in conjunction with inotropes for managing critically ill patients. It covers the significance of measuring ionized calcium, discusses the use of calcium chloride versus calcium gluconate, and assesses clinical markers for shock management. Real-life case studies illustrate the complexities of cardiac function assessment and decision-making in the use of inotropes amidst various patient scenarios.
